Scissor lifts are essential equipment in many industries, providing a safe and efficient way to lift workers and materials to heights. However, for scissor lifts to operate effectively, they require the use of ramps to allow for easy access and loading. ramps for scissor lifts are a crucial component that ensures the safe and efficient operation of these machines.
ramps for scissor lifts come in a variety of shapes and sizes, designed to fit different types of scissor lifts and accommodate various uses. These ramps are typically made from durable materials like steel or aluminum, capable of withstanding the weight and pressure of the equipment being loaded onto the lift. When choosing ramps for scissor lifts, it is essential to consider factors like the weight capacity, the height of the lift, and the type of equipment that will be loaded onto it.
